Central Bank of Turkey Lowers Policy Rate to 40.5%

The decision marks a slower phase of monetary easing as the Turkish central bank adjusts its policy rate.

Terms & Concepts
  • Policy Interest Rate: The benchmark rate set by a central bank to influence the cost of borrowing and lending within the economy.
  • Monetary Easing: A central bank strategy to lower interest rates or take other measures to stimulate economic growth.
